- What makes this different from other programs?
- Two things: I teach, not just motivate — you leave knowing the mechanism behind your training and nutrition, not just following orders. And my nutrition coaching is backed by 20 years as a chef, not a weekend course — so when I talk food, it's real, practical knowledge, not macros off a spreadsheet. Training itself is evidence-based frequency work — hitting each muscle roughly twice a week, hard but sustainable — rather than the destroy-yourself style most gyms push.
